Raymond James Financial Preferred stock dividends increased by 100.0% to $2.00M in Q1 2026 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ric was flat by 0.0%, from $2.00M to $2.00M. Over 3 years (FY 2022 to FY 2025), Preferred stock dividends shows an upward trend with a 7.7% CAGR. This increase may warrant attention — for this metric, lower values are generally preferred.
